Understanding Box Type Substations

A box type substation is a compact, prefabricated electrical substation designed to transform voltage levels and distribute electrical power safely and efficiently. These substations are widely used in industrial plants, commercial complexes, residential projects, and utility networks.

The main components of a box type substation include the transformer, switchgear, protection devices, control panels, and auxiliary equipment. They are typically housed in a durable metal enclosure, which protects the equipment from environmental conditions such as rain, dust, and temperature fluctuations.

Box type substations are particularly valued for their flexibility and ease of installation. They can be installed outdoors or indoors and are available in different voltage levels, including low voltage (LV) and medium voltage (MV) configurations. Their modular design allows for customization according to project-specific requirements, making them ideal for a wide range of applications.

Types of Box Type Substations Available

Box type substations come in a variety of configurations to suit different industrial applications:

  • Low Voltage Substations: Designed for distribution of electricity at voltages below 1 kV, ideal for small to medium commercial projects.
  • Medium Voltage Substations: Handle voltages from 1 kV to 36 kV, commonly used in industrial plants and urban power distribution.
  • Compact vs Modular Designs: Compact substations combine all components in a single enclosure, while modular designs allow expansion and customization.
  • Custom Solutions: Experienced manufacturers can tailor substations to specific project requirements, including dimensions, voltage rating, and safety features.

How Box Type Substations Work

Box type substations function by stepping down high-voltage electricity from the utility grid to a lower, usable voltage for industrial or commercial applications. The process includes:

  • Receiving high-voltage power from the grid.
  • Passing the power through transformers to reduce voltage levels.
  • Using switchgear to control and protect the electrical flow.
  • Distributing the electricity safely to connected loads.

Safety features such as circuit breakers, fuses, and protective relays are integrated to prevent overloads, short circuits, and other electrical faults. Understanding these mechanisms is crucial when selecting a manufacturer who can provide reliable and compliant substations.

Installation and Maintenance Tips

Proper installation and regular maintenance are key to maximizing the lifespan of a box type substation:

  • Installation: Position the substation on a stable foundation, ensure proper grounding, and follow manufacturer guidelines for electrical connections.
  • Maintenance: Regularly inspect components, check insulation resistance, clean dust and debris, and test protective devices.
  • Troubleshooting: Identify issues early to prevent costly downtime; common problems include transformer overheating, switchgear malfunctions, and moisture ingress.

Cost Considerations and ROI

Investing in a high-quality box type substation may seem costly upfront, but the long-term benefits often outweigh initial expenses. Key cost factors include transformer capacity, switchgear type, enclosure material, and customization level.

Substation FeatureDescriptionImpact on Cost
Transformer RatingDetermines the load capacityHigh-capacity transformers increase cost
Switchgear TypeMV or LV, compact or modularAdvanced switchgear raises price
Enclosure MaterialSteel, stainless steel, or weatherproof panelsDurable materials cost more but last longer
CustomizationSpecial dimensions, features, or smart integrationHigher customization increases cost
Certification & TestingISO, IEC complianceEnsures reliability, may affect price
